Output 320af77e424a166e1433eefd719a877642cde8bee2c8c1ae0428d57831e58794:62

value
45422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a8517bd843a4bd706db90017e8a5175ed05f32 OP_EQUAL
address
3DRJ44LJQKJRdJqbYp5ju5P3n7yXA71Aq1
transaction
320af77e424a166e1433eefd719a877642cde8bee2c8c1ae0428d57831e58794
spent
true